If you have carpet that is glued to concrete and you want to remove it, there are a few things you can do. One option is to use a heat gun or a steam stripper. This will help to loosen the adhesive and make it easier to remove the ... Web27 jan. 2024 · A more budget-friendly approach would be to use a floor stripper to remove the rubber backing. Unlike a ride-on floor scraper, you can rent a floor stripper at most hardware stores like Home Depot. Renting one will cost you $67 for four hours of use. If you'd like to use it for the whole day, it will cost around $95.

Web26 sep. 2010 · Step 1 – Scraping the Carpet Glue Remove as much of the carpet glue as possible by scraping it using a razor blade scraper. The scraper can easily remove big chunks of the glue, which helps get the job done more easily later. Step 2 – Use Boiling Water Boiling water will soften up hard-to-remove glue. Web20 mrt. 2024 · To detach the carpet from the tack strip that holds the carpet in place along walls, start in a corner; just grab the carpet with pliers and pull. Then grab the carpet by hand and continue to pull it up along an entire wall. Fold back about 3 ft. of carpet and cut it into easy-to-handle strips (Photo 1). Web20 jul. 2024 · Getting rid of stuck carpet padding is a simple process: Scrape off the top layer of the foam using a utility knife. Use a sharp-edged scraper to reach the glued layer beneath. Use a mixture of adhesive remover and warm water to apply on the glued-down layer. Wash the remaining glue off with warm water and dishwashing liquid. Web9 apr. 2024 · Scraping. Pour it onto any areas of carpet glue residue on a concrete surface. … how many meters are in 45.7 kmWeb8 feb. 2024 · Add adhesive remover to the floor and spread it around. Cover the area with plastic. Let the glue remover rest for 1-3 hours. Test to see how easily it will scrape off. Using your hand-scraping tools continue to work to get the glue off the concrete. Use a mop and soapy water or a sponge to get rid of glue residue. how are meta rules useful in data miningWebThis is 2-3 years down the line.
